The hexadecimal color code #9CEDCE corresponds to the code RGB( 156, 237, 206 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,61 level), green (at 0,93 level) and blue (at 0,81 level). Its brightness is 77% and its saturation is 69%. It is composed of red at 26%, green at 39% and blue at 34%.
